No biggie. 2nd prob is *some* MP3's play either slowly or too fast. I'm sure this is nothing whatsoever to do with VbPlayer, but wondered if you'd come across the prob and/or if you knew a fix. Driving me up the wall. Each MP3 I have a prob with is fine locally, is fine when I download it from the server suing a hyperlink, BUT when played thru VbPlayer, it's speed is screwed up. Any clues? |
Quote:
As for the speed differences on mp3's, this wouldn't be the player causing the problems, but the actual mp3 encoding. If you have varying bitrates, then the mp3's will sound like they are speeding up or slowing down. If you encode all mp3's to use a fixed bitrate of 128k then it should fix this little problem. |
